FIND AFFORDABLE ROOFING SERVICES AT KEEP DRY ROOFING MARYLAND HEIGHTS MO NEAR YOU.


Comprehensive Roofing Solutions Joilet for All Needs

Top Professional Tips for Hiring Roof Covering ServicesWhen it pertains to picking roof covering services, the know-how and integrity of the professional play an essential duty in the end result of your task. Ensuring that you follow expert suggestions can be the difference between a seamless roofing experience and potential headaches down the line

read more

All about Weathercraft Roofing Company Of North Platte

The Facts About Weathercraft Roofing Company Of North Platte RevealedTable of ContentsThe smart Trick of Weathercraft Roofing Company Of North Platte That Nobody is Talking AboutOur Weathercraft Roofing Company Of North Platte PDFsThe Ultimate Guide To Weathercraft Roofing Company Of North PlatteWeathercraft Roofing Company Of North Platte for Begi

read more